Bag om History Of St. Andrews

""History of St. Andrews: With a Full Account of the Recent Improvements in the City"" is a historical book written by Charles Roger in 1849. The book provides a comprehensive account of the city of St. Andrews, located in Scotland, from its earliest days to the mid-19th century. The author explores the city's rich history, including its founding, growth, and development over time. The book also covers notable events that took place in St. Andrews, such as the establishment of the university, the construction of the cathedral, and the role the city played in the Scottish Reformation. In addition to the historical account, the book also provides a detailed description of the recent improvements that were made in the city at the time of its publication. This includes information on the construction of new buildings, roads, and other infrastructure projects that helped to modernize the city.
